| Copyright | (c) 2013-2023 Brendan Hay |
|---|---|
| License | Mozilla Public License, v. 2.0. |
| Maintainer | Brendan Hay |
| Stability | auto-generated |
| Portability | non-portable (GHC extensions) |
| Safe Haskell | Safe-Inferred |
| Language | Haskell2010 |
Amazonka.IoTWireless.Types.LoRaWANUpdateGatewayTaskCreate
Description
Synopsis
- data LoRaWANUpdateGatewayTaskCreate = LoRaWANUpdateGatewayTaskCreate' {}
- newLoRaWANUpdateGatewayTaskCreate :: LoRaWANUpdateGatewayTaskCreate
- loRaWANUpdateGatewayTaskCreate_currentVersion :: Lens' LoRaWANUpdateGatewayTaskCreate (Maybe LoRaWANGatewayVersion)
- loRaWANUpdateGatewayTaskCreate_sigKeyCrc :: Lens' LoRaWANUpdateGatewayTaskCreate (Maybe Natural)
- loRaWANUpdateGatewayTaskCreate_updateSignature :: Lens' LoRaWANUpdateGatewayTaskCreate (Maybe Text)
- loRaWANUpdateGatewayTaskCreate_updateVersion :: Lens' LoRaWANUpdateGatewayTaskCreate (Maybe LoRaWANGatewayVersion)
Documentation
data LoRaWANUpdateGatewayTaskCreate Source #
LoRaWANUpdateGatewayTaskCreate object.
See: newLoRaWANUpdateGatewayTaskCreate smart constructor.
Constructors
| LoRaWANUpdateGatewayTaskCreate' | |
Fields
| |
Instances
newLoRaWANUpdateGatewayTaskCreate :: LoRaWANUpdateGatewayTaskCreate Source #
Create a value of LoRaWANUpdateGatewayTaskCreate with all optional fields omitted.
Use generic-lens or optics to modify other optional fields.
The following record fields are available, with the corresponding lenses provided for backwards compatibility:
$sel:currentVersion:LoRaWANUpdateGatewayTaskCreate', loRaWANUpdateGatewayTaskCreate_currentVersion - The version of the gateways that should receive the update.
$sel:sigKeyCrc:LoRaWANUpdateGatewayTaskCreate', loRaWANUpdateGatewayTaskCreate_sigKeyCrc - The CRC of the signature private key to check.
$sel:updateSignature:LoRaWANUpdateGatewayTaskCreate', loRaWANUpdateGatewayTaskCreate_updateSignature - The signature used to verify the update firmware.
$sel:updateVersion:LoRaWANUpdateGatewayTaskCreate', loRaWANUpdateGatewayTaskCreate_updateVersion - The firmware version to update the gateway to.
loRaWANUpdateGatewayTaskCreate_currentVersion :: Lens' LoRaWANUpdateGatewayTaskCreate (Maybe LoRaWANGatewayVersion) Source #
The version of the gateways that should receive the update.
loRaWANUpdateGatewayTaskCreate_sigKeyCrc :: Lens' LoRaWANUpdateGatewayTaskCreate (Maybe Natural) Source #
The CRC of the signature private key to check.
loRaWANUpdateGatewayTaskCreate_updateSignature :: Lens' LoRaWANUpdateGatewayTaskCreate (Maybe Text) Source #
The signature used to verify the update firmware.
loRaWANUpdateGatewayTaskCreate_updateVersion :: Lens' LoRaWANUpdateGatewayTaskCreate (Maybe LoRaWANGatewayVersion) Source #
The firmware version to update the gateway to.